Transaction 7943edee615236ba548b6f795afe61b5c75c3e5760e04fb96000142e24637e41

2 Input
2 Outputs
  • 7943edee615236ba548b6f795afe61b5c75c3e5760e04fb96000142e24637e41:0
  • value  1219647
    address  1PmAgVd96rpkeerEQV24jjhSYSwGCaXPad
  • 7943edee615236ba548b6f795afe61b5c75c3e5760e04fb96000142e24637e41:1
  • value  14601563
    address  14Ur8HV9H57vvysgwZQRSAkrKg2apxuUjQ